The Blue Box's Revelation: The Secret of the Blue

In the heart of a bustling city, where the skyscrapers whispered secrets of their own, lived a young artist named Elara. Her life was a canvas of mundane routines, each stroke of her brush a testament to the ordinariness she had come to accept. Her apartment, a small, sunlit room filled with the scent of coffee and the soft hum of city life, was her sanctuary, a place where her dreams found a temporary respite from the world's chaos.

One evening, as the s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den glow over the city, Elara found herself at the edge of her bed, lost in thought. Her eyes drifted to the cluttered desk, where a stack of sketches and half-finished paintings lay abandoned. With a sigh, she picked up a fresh canvas, her fingers dancing over the blank surface, searching for inspiration.

It was then, amidst the chaos of her thoughts, that she noticed a small, intricately carved blue box sitting on the shelf, hidden behind a stack of art books. It was unlike anything she had seen before, its surface etched with symbols that seemed to pulse with a life of their own. Curiosity piqued, she reached out and lifted the box from its perch.

The moment she touched it, a wave of dizziness washed over her. The world seemed to spin, and for a moment, she thought she might faint. But as the dizziness subsided, a feeling of clarity washed over her. She felt as if she had stepped into a different dimension, one where the rules of her world no longer applied.

Elara opened the box, and a single, shimmering blue feather fell into her hand. It was unlike any feather she had ever seen, its edges glowing with an ethereal light. She examined it closely, feeling a strange connection to it, as if it held the key to something she had long forgotten.

As she held the feather, a voice echoed in her mind, a voice she recognized as her own. "Elara, you have been chosen," it said. "The blue box is a vessel of ancient power, and you are its guardian."

Puzzled, Elara looked around the room, but saw no one. She shook her head, trying to clear the cobwebs of confusion. But the voice continued, this time more forcefully. "The blue box holds the secret of the Blue, a truth that has been hidden for centuries. You must find it, protect it, and unlock its power."

With those words, the room around her seemed to blur, and she was enveloped in a swirling vortex of colors and sounds. She felt herself being pulled through a tunnel of light, and when she emerged, she found herself standing in a vast, ancient city.

The architecture was unlike anything she had ever seen, towering structures made of a material that seemed to glow with its own inner light. As she wandered through the streets, she noticed that the people around her were dressed in clothes that seemed to have been lifted from a bygone era. They moved with a sense of purpose, their eyes filled with a knowing that Elara could not fathom.

She followed them to a grand temple at the center of the city, its doors made of a shimmering blue material that seemed to absorb the light around it. As she stepped inside, she felt a sense of awe and reverence. The air was thick with the scent of incense, and the walls were adorned with intricate carvings that depicted scenes of a world long gone.

In the center of the temple stood a pedestal, upon which rested a large, ornate box, its surface etched with the same symbols as the blue box she had found in her apartment. As she approached the pedestal, the box seemed to come alive, its surface pulsing with a light that seemed to reach out and touch her.

"Elara," the voice echoed once more, "you are the key to unlocking the Blue. You must use your art to reveal the truth that has been hidden for so long."

Elara took a deep breath, feeling the weight of her new responsibility settle upon her shoulders. She reached out and touched the box, and a surge of energy coursed through her veins. The symbols on the box began to glow brighter, and the air around her seemed to hum with a life of its own.

With a sense of determination, she closed her eyes and let her artistic abilities flow through her. She saw images of a world in turmoil, of darkness threatening to engulf the light. But within that darkness, there was hope, and within that hope, there was the power of the Blue.

As she opened her eyes, the room around her seemed to change. The ancient city had vanished, and she was once again in her apartment, standing before the blue box. The symbols on its surface glowed with a newfound brilliance, and she felt a sense of peace wash over her.

She knew that her life had changed forever. She was no longer just an artist; she was the guardian of the Blue, the key to unlocking a truth that had been hidden for centuries. With a sense of purpose, she reached for her brush, ready to face the challenges that lay ahead.

Elara's journey had only just begun, and the secret of the Blue was about to be revealed.
